Today’s Science Tomorrow’s Art
Two programs were created in OpenGL/C++ to generate the images, along with a custom animatable font. The first handled the streaming text background. It increases the rate at which letters are typed, motion-blurring fast images. The second program generates the running man. Random letters are drawn (according to specified animation parameters), and their color intensity is determined by the pixels covered in the Muybridge images. A sequence of images is read in, and animation parameters are applied to the animatable font.
